I just set up my shop (not my first Shopify store). I have set up 3 shipping zones Canada (where I am), cross border to the USA, and rest of world. the problem is, when a customer is checking out, only Canada shows as an option in the Country dropdown. 

 

Please let me know the solution, everything I've read just tells me how to set up a shipping zone, which is already done, but not translating to showing up in the checkout.

Hi @Melissacrow 

 

You should check your Market setting by going to the Setting and selecting the Markets section.

I believe that you have not activated the international market yet so the only primary market (Canada) is showed up in the dropdown menu at checkout.

As mentioned, this could happen in case you have Shopify Markets. Shopify Market settings have a higher priority than your shipping zone settings. For example, let’s say that you have the USA with shipping rates available, but it is also an inactive market in your Market settings. Even though there are shipping rates available, customers can't place an order because the USA is an inactive market.

 

If you have Markets enabled on your account, head to Settings > Markets to check if the USA has been enabled. To add countries, select Manage > Activate market. Then you should see additional countries within the dropdown options on your checkout page.
